Uncovering Hidden Treasures: A Beginner's Guide to State Quarter Collecting
Uncovering hidden treasures is an exciting endeavor, especially for beginners delving into the world of state quarter collecting. This unique hobby allows enthusiasts to explore the rich history and diversity of each U.S. state through meticulously designed quarters. Each quarter serves as a miniature time capsule, encapsulating significant landmarks, cultural symbols, and memorable figures that define the character of its issuing state.
For those new to state quarter collecting, the journey begins with acquiring a comprehensive guide or album to organize and catalog their collection. It’s essential to look for authentic quarters in good condition, ensuring they meet grading standards. Regularly visiting local coin shops or participating in numismatic events can provide access to rare finds and valuable insights from experienced collectors.

Ethical Considerations in Restoring Rare Currency Collections
Restoring rare currency collections, especially in the niche world of state quarter collecting, presents a unique set of ethical challenges. Each piece holds historical value and significance for collectors and enthusiasts alike. When considering restoration, it’s paramount to balance the desire to preserve rarity with the need to maintain authenticity. Every intervention must be carefully evaluated to ensure the integrity of the collection’s legacy.
Professional restorers often face a delicate task, as even the most subtle repairs can impact the overall value and market perception. In state quarter collecting, where every detail matters, ethical restoration practices involve minimal manipulation, focusing on conservation over enhancement. The goal is to stabilize the currency, ensuring its longevity without altering its original state, thereby preserving its historical veracity for future generations of collectors.
